Community Happenings

A few things of note:
  • Apoc has banned or disqualified more than 75 cheaters and disconnectors from the C&C 3 online ladder. It's good to see EA doing their best to make sure the online ladder stays fun and cheat-free. You can read more about this in Apoc's post.
  • HeXetic from PlanetCNC has written a new article, discussing the flaws in C&C 3 interface. It's very well done and should be required reading for EA and any interface designers.
  • Episode 2 of EA's video series Command School recently was launched. It discusses things like garrisoning, the Scrin firepower in the late game, and how to pull of a very powerful Shadow Team rush. Watch it at C&C TV.
  • Command and Crysis: The Dead 6, a mod that has been in development for as long as I can remember, posted a huge media extravaganza. There's no doubt that the engine they are using (from Crysis) lets them create extraordinary art. You can view it here.
  • A new mod called C&C Justice has been released. It features walls and Tiberium tribute, and lets Cranes build defenses again. You can get it from FileFront.
